The Club:

Founded in 1904, Champaign Country Club is a private, full-service country club, located in Champaign, Illinois. With a championship golf course originally designed by Tom Bendelow, and later redesigned by Edward Lawrence Packard. Champaign Country Club continues to fulfill its original mission as a family club devoted to the game of golf, while offering a growing range of sports and social opportunities. Sports at Champaign include golf, tennis, and swimming. Members of all ages enjoy a year-round schedule of exciting social activities.

 Champaign Country Club consists of bent/poa greens, tees, and fairways. Recent improvements to the golf course have included a new irrigation well and pump station. The bunkers were recently rebuilt to Better Billy Bunker. We are currently in the planning process of building a new maintenance facility, and could break ground in fall of this year!
